SRS + Electronic Issues

Hello everyone,

I recently purchased an '03 evo. After much digging here are the problems I have found.

1. Both front impact sensors are gone, on one side the wires were cut.
2. Hazard light fuse was pulled. When I put a new one in it, the hazards are on constantly even without the ignition in the off position.
3. The horn is unplugged. When plugged back in the horn is on constantly with key out.
4. The seat belts are locked into place with the driver side having enough slack to still buckle and the passenger is locked and retracted completely.
5. There is no bumper under the bumper cover.
6. The car draws .2 amperes when the vehicle is off and the fuses in the yellow sleeve are pulled and the hazard fuse pulled. When the fuses in the yellow sleeve are in, it draws .7 amperes. That explains why I had to get a new battery.

Symptoms 1-5 and possibly 6 indicate the vehicle was in a front end collision.(the car even has an aftermarket bumper cover.) Now I know that I will need to replace the seat belts, I already have someone selling them to me. The impact sensors I hope I can find on any 03-05 lancer(correct me if I'm wrong). The computer will most likely need to be cleared by a dealership or hopefully a shop(correct me if I'm wrong again).

7. My gauge lights do not work but my indicator lights work for example when brights are on or doors are open the little indicator light in the dash comes on but I cannot see the speedo or tach at night.
8. My power locks do not work. Is this in relation to the impact sensors?
9. The turn signals do not work. Most definitely related to the hazard fuse.
10. The radiator fan is gone. Please let me know if I should get one/if it is needed.

Here are several pictures I have snapped showing these problems.















I checked the sticky about electrical gremlins related to the kickpanel seal. I checked my conntectors under that kickpanel and they look ok. But the seal is definitely not sealed.

I want to make this car legal and safe first and foremost. What should I do?

HOLY ELECTRICAL NIGHTMARE BATMAN!!

Ok first thing I would do is find that amp draw. Sounds like they tried to put in an alarm and failed miserably. Look up how to test for amp draw off the battery and start pulling fuses one at a time till you find your problem area and you see .000 amps. Then you can start looking to wherever that is at.

As for the door locks, it looked like you were missing a relay under the bay for it. Try getting that OEM relay or something comparable. If that doesn't work check the fuse for the locks. If that fails then you got some cut wires more than likely.

Oh and the horn is getting a constant ground somewhere. Could be the switch, could be the horn trigger, something is not proper though.

Man oh man looks like a project don't give up.

I'd get the factory service manual ASAP (if you don't have one). If not pm me. It'll have the entire wiring schematic for the car. Connectors and all. You'll need to junkyard or OEM the missing sensors and connectors. The impacts are yellow.

My guess is the reason those fuses and relays are missing is that theres a short and as soon as you plug a new one in its goona pop.
